•Agent(e) du service à la clientèle (piste) - Canada (https://delta.avature.net/customerserviceagentFR33455) As a Baggage Handler/Ramp Operator, you will work with an innovative team whose common goal is to ensure that our customers' baggage and cargo arrives safely and on time to drive a positive customer experience. Responsibilities for this position include, but are not limited to:

+ Safely lift,load, unload, and transport baggage, mail, and cargo to and from aircraft

+ Responsible foron-time connections by guiding incoming and departing aircrafts from thegate positions

+ Safeguard cargo,baggage and mail from damage, loss, and weather

+ Safely drive andoperate ground equipment such as tugs, belt loaders, and tow tractors inareas of congestion

+ Repeatedly liftand load baggage onto carts and ensure each bag reaches its destination

+ Operate baggagescanners and computers to ensure baggage and cargo are routed correctly tothe passenger's destination

+ Practices safetyconscious behaviors in all operational processes and procedures What you need to succeed (minimum qualifications)
